Contractor Lead Generation: Proven Alternatives to Angi (HomeAdvisor)
Finding reliable customers for your contracting firm doesn’t require depend on sites similar to Angi (formerly HomeAdvisor). While Angi is a common option, the considerable fees and unpredictable customer origins have driven many tradespeople to seek out more effective alternatives. Here’s a review of some tested approaches for obtaining valuable leads:
- SEO-Focused Website: Develop a organic optimized website to bring in interested clients searching for your expertise.
- Local Partnerships: Network with related businesses like real estate agents, interior designers, and property managers.
- Social Media Marketing: Utilize sites including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n to highlight your work and reach your ideal clients.
- Content Marketing: Create helpful guides and videos covering repair subjects to establish yourself a respected authority.
- Paid Advertising (Google Ads): Run targeted promotions on search engines to find people searching for your assistance.
These methods often deliver a better outcome and greater control over your customer pipeline.
